Basic facts about this digital color

The digital color #BC97A7 is classified in the Register under the Rose Color Family, with Low Saturation and Very Light brightness. In numbers: rgb(188, 151, 167) (73.7% red, 59.2% green, 65.5% blue), or CMYK 0 / 15 / 8 / 26 for print. Curious how these numbers work? Read our RGB color codes guide.

#BC97A7 is a softly toned pink-red rose that has a delicate, washed-out lightness. It is a natural fit for airy backdrops, whitespace-heavy designs and gentle gradients. In The Official Register of Color Names it is almost identical to Mesmerise (#B598A3). Slightly further away sit Light Mauve (#C292A1) and Lilac Luster (#AE98AA).

The recipe behind #BC97A7 is rgb(188, 151, 167), with red as the dominant ingredient. On this background, black text reaches a 8.1:1 contrast ratio (passing WCAG AAA); white stays at 2.6:1. #BC97A7 color harmonies

Color harmonies are pleasing color schemes created according to their position on a color wheel.

Complementary

Complementary color schemes are made by picking two opposite colors con the color wheel. They appear vibrant near to each other.

Split complementary

Split complementary schemes are like complementary but they uses two adiacent colors of the complement. They are more flexible than complementary ones.

Analogous

Analogous color schemes are made by picking three col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. They are perceived as calm and serene.

Triadic

Triadic color schemes are created by picking three colors equally spaced on the color wheel. They appear quite contrasted and multicolored.

Tetradic

Tetradic color schemes are made form two couples of complementary colors in a rectangular shape on the color wheel.

Square

Square color schemes are like tetradic arranged in a square instead of rectangle. Colors appear even more contrasting.
